中东壕客下单:先订600台!飞行汽车海外最大订单来了
Nan Fang Du Shi Bao· 2025-10-13 03:37
Core Insights - The article highlights the successful public flight of the "Land Aircraft Carrier," a split-type flying car developed by Guangdong Huitian Aerospace Technology Co., marking a significant milestone in the personal flying era [2][10][12] - Huitian has launched its international brand "ARIDGE" and a new logo, signaling its global expansion efforts and the establishment of a new brand identity [13][14] - The company has signed a historic order for 600 flying cars in the Middle East, the largest overseas order in the flying car sector to date, laying a solid foundation for its global market penetration [5][12] Company Developments - Huitian's "Land Aircraft Carrier" has successfully completed its first manned flight, demonstrating its technological maturity and operational capabilities [8][10] - The flying vehicle supports both manual and automatic driving modes, with the manual mode designed to simplify operation, making flying more accessible [8][10] - The company plans to enter the Middle Eastern market by 2027, with existing orders already in place [4][11] Market Strategy - The Middle East is identified as Huitian's first strategic high ground for global expansion, with a significant order base established [4][5] - The company aims to leverage the projected growth of the global eVTOL market, expected to reach $225 billion by 2040, with the Middle East market alone projected at $11.7 billion [11] - Huitian's new brand "ARIDGE" symbolizes its vision of becoming a global leader in low-altitude products, enhancing its market presence [13][14] Production and R&D - Huitian's manufacturing facility, capable of producing up to 10,000 units annually, is set to begin operations in 2026, marking a new phase of large-scale production for Chinese flying cars [17] - The company is also developing a new high-speed, long-range flying car named A868, targeting long-distance travel needs [18] - Huitian has received a total of 7,000 orders for the "Land Aircraft Carrier," indicating strong market demand [15]

从展厅到蓝天 创新保险护航低空经济“起飞”
Shang Hai Zheng Quan Bao· 2025-05-14 18:51
Core Viewpoint - The low-altitude economy is rapidly emerging as a new trillion-yuan industry, with innovations in insurance mechanisms becoming crucial for addressing risks associated with its development [1][6]. Group 1: Low-altitude Economy Development - The low-altitude economy is expanding from regional exploration to a national scale, with significant projects like drone delivery in rural areas and cross-province passenger flights during holidays [1]. - The development of low-altitude economy projects faces various uncertainties, making risk management essential for project success and corporate confidence [1]. Group 2: Insurance Innovations - Insurance innovations are being introduced across various regions to address the risk management needs of low-altitude economy projects, enhancing the overall security of these initiatives [1][2]. - The insurance solutions have evolved from simple policies to comprehensive risk management plans that cover all aspects of low-altitude flight operations [2][3]. Group 3: Commercial Applications - After successful test flights, low-altitude aircraft are moving towards commercial applications, serving diverse industries such as emergency rescue and industrial manufacturing [4][5]. - Companies like Zongheng Co. have established manufacturing bases for industrial drones, which are increasingly used in disaster response scenarios [4]. Group 4: Government and Local Initiatives - Local governments are recognizing the importance of insurance in the low-altitude economy and are actively exploring insurance solutions to meet emerging demands [6][7]. - Guangdong province has taken the lead in developing low-altitude economy insurance, launching the first dedicated insurance products to cover risks associated with low-altitude operations [6][7]. Group 5: Market Potential and Future Outlook - The demand for insurance in the low-altitude economy is expected to grow significantly, with projections indicating a market size of 8 to 10 billion yuan by 2035 [7]. - Collaboration among government, insurance companies, and enterprises is essential to build a robust insurance ecosystem that supports the low-altitude economy [7].
